The Centre
The Rumpus Room Darling St boasts large and varied play and learning environments. We have an inviting natural outdoor space to explore including risky play, veggie gardens, a mud kitchen, a COLA for progressive morning and afternoon tea, a jungle area and 2 large sandpits. We care for many animals including free range chickens, a bunny, turtles, birds and more.

To be considered, you will have:
- A Bachelor in Early Childhood Education
- Prior experience in long day-care
- Sound, practical working knowledge and implementation of the NQF and the EYLF
- Current Working with Children’s Check.
